Husky rescued from mountain on stretcher after injuring paws
- A mountain rescue team carried a husky named Prince down Scafell after he injured his paws during a long walk with his owner, James Briscoe.
- Briscoe became exhausted trying to carry Prince, who weighs about 35kg, back down using a rescue sling.
- The rescue operation involved 11 volunteers and lasted nearly six hours to bring them to safety.
- After being rescued, Prince was calm and accepted the stretcher while enjoying attention from rescuers and onlookers.
